Subject: Undo/redo cut-over — done!

Hi, welcome aboard! Quick recap before you dig into Sketchlark: we finished the cut-over to the new history service (codename Palimpsest) last Thursday. Undo and redo now go through a shared command log instead of per-tab snapshots, so cross-pane edits finally behave. Old snapshot code is still in the repo but dead — ignore it. Rehearse a rollback once so you know the dance. When you set up your local instance, use these configuration values:

deployment values, kahap-bahap:
ralwyn:
  pin: 6328
  metrics_host: metrics.ralwyn.tolvaqsys.internal
  tenant: pelys
  seal: seal_44957d22

Subject: Flagpole cut-over complete

Plugin authors: the cut-over to Flagpole v3 finished last night. Legacy evaluation endpoints are gone. All plugins must target the v3 resolver contract; stale caches were flushed during the window. Rollbacks are no longer possible. Update your manifests before the next publish cycle. The production resolver now runs with the following settings.

config for bawig-fadup:
[zorix]
host = zorix.lumicworks.corp
user = zorix_svc
database = zorix_prod

Title: Scheduler double-waters bed 3 after DST shift

New folks: the Verdella scheduler stores watering slots in local time. After the clock change, slot 06:00 fires twice, soaking the herb bed. Fix: store UTC, convert at display. Repro on the Oakhollow test rig only. To reproduce, install the firmware identified by the token below.

build token for hafop-kahog: htk31_a432ac515d5bb1362002c1e1a7e80ef

Subject: Gallerio audio-guide sync — next steps

Hi folks,

Quick update on the Gallerio integration for the Marrowfield Museum pilot. The audio-guide app now pulls exhibit narrations from your content hub every 15 minutes, and the offline bundle fallback is working nicely. Support team: if a visitor reports missing tracks, check the sync log first — nine times out of ten it's a stale manifest.

For testing against the staging hub, authenticate your requests with the token below.

login token, bagug-kafop: eyJhbGciOiJIUzI1NiIsInR5cCI6IkpXVCJ9.eyJzdWIiOiIcMLov2In0.Z5RLDIfp